Award Winner’s Chocolate Pecan Pie

This is one of the winning recipes from a pie contest I saw on the Food Network and was a huge hit at thanksgiving. For some reason I managed to take a picture of the unbaked pie, but not the finished product. It looks even better baked!

Unbaked pie shell
4 eggs
1 cup sugar
1 cup light corn syrup
1 oz. unsweetened chocolate, melted
3 TBS melted butter
2 tsp vanilla extract
¼ tsp salt
2 cups pecans, toasted, chop 1 cup
½ cup chocolate chips

Preheat oven to 350.

Toast pecans on cookie sheet.

In a large bowl lightly beat eggs. Stir in sugar, corn syrup, melted chocolate, butter, vanilla and salt.

Into prepared crust layer chocolate chips, 1 cup chopped pecans, then carefully arrange 2nd cup of pecans in pan. Slowly pour egg mixture over pecans, deflecting with a spoon to prevent moving pecans.

Bake for 15 min at 350. Cover edge with foil or pie shield. Bake for another 40 min. until knife inserted in center comes out clean.
